I've been coming to Ash for a long time and really appreciate his honest work. I brought my guitar for a regular string change, polish etc, however I asked if it was possible to bring the action down a bit at the same time. I tried to lower the bridge myself and it wouldn't budge, and he checked the relief which was ok. I wasn't expecting him to dig into it deeper, but he discovered that there was a hidden crack where the neck is bolted on, and the screws weren't set probably from the factory setup. He fixed it and now the action is perfect. I really appreciate him taking the extra time to explore the issue, and he didn't charge me extra for it either which is very kind. Thank you!

Ash is a fantastic tech. I had him look after a prized possession, my grandfather's 335. Before it made its way to becoming mine, it had been improperly stored and all the electronics were corroded and the wood was all dried up. It was in need of some proper care. Ash took care of all of that. Fixed some fret issues, gave it a great setup, and replaced all the wiring, gave it some new pots along with a new switch and a new jacks. He brought it back to life and I couldn't be happier with the care and service he provided. A great tech,and an honest guy. If you're looking for someone to take care of your gear, Ash is the guy
